Ich habe zwei Datenbanktabellen. Einer von ihnen ist auf meinem lokalen Server und ein anderer ist auf einem externen System. Aktualisieren der lokalen Servertabelle (anfangs sind beide identisch), wenn Änderungen in der externen Systemtabelle mit Hibernate vorgenommen werden. Ich habe dieses auf alle Datenbanken implementieren (dh SQL/Oracle)Wie kann die Synchronisation s/w zwei Datenbanktabellen implementiert werden?
0
A
Antwort
0
, dass die Replikation entweder periodisch Verwendung Batch-Prozess ist oder Replikation http://dev.mysql.com/doc/refman/5.7/en/replication.html
Sie können auch FÖDERIERTE Tischkonzept
verwenden für Ihre Datenbank implementierenVerwandte Themen
- 1. Wie kann die Delegierung richtig implementiert werden?
- 2. Synchronisation zwischen zwei Aufgaben
- 3. Synchronisation von zwei Threads
- 4. Wie kann ich zwei Datenbanktabellen mit PHP synchronisieren?
- 5. Wie kann ich zwei identische Datenbanktabellen mit LINQ abgleichen?
- 6. View.onclicklistener kann nicht implementiert werden
- 7. Wie kann Vererbung in C# implementiert werden?
- 8. Wie kann Admob in Ionic implementiert werden?
- 9. Wie kann ich garantieren, dass ein Typ, der keine Synchronisation implementiert, tatsächlich sicher zwischen Threads geteilt werden kann?
- 10. Wie kann die Benutzeranmeldung in Rails am besten implementiert werden?
- 11. Wie kann ein Compiler, der die Iteratoren erkennt, implementiert werden?
- 12. Generierte geschachtelte JSON-Daten aus zwei Datenbanktabellen
- 13. Wie funktioniert die Synchronisation in StringBuffer?
- 14. Kann diese Parallelität in OpenCL implementiert werden
- 15. Wie werden Mitgliedstypen implementiert?
- 16. Inner Synchronisation auf das gleiche Objekt wie die äußere Synchronisation
- 17. Wie behalte ich ein EnumSet (mit zwei Datenbanktabellen)?
- 18. Wie kann ich die Synchronisation meiner blockierenden Queue-Implementierung testen
- 19. SQLserver Datenbank Synchronisation zwischen zwei Servern
- 20. Kann django-activity-stream-Datenbanktabellen nicht installiert werden
- 21. Wie werden iomanip-Funktionen implementiert?
- 22. Wie kann der Vergleich für eine Basisklasse korrekt implementiert werden?
- 23. Wie werden DOM-Parser implementiert?
- 24. Wie werden Go-Kanäle implementiert?
- 25. Oracle: Wie werden Sequenzen implementiert?
- 26. Kann die dynamische Validierung auf Elementebene implementiert werden?
- 27. Kann eine Blockchain ohne Bitcoin implementiert werden?
- 28. Warum kann die Schnittstelle mit Zeiger Empfänger implementiert werden
- 29. Warum kann die Überladung nicht zur Laufzeit implementiert werden?
- 30. Wie werden delete und delete [] implementiert?
Ich denke, Sie vermeiden zu versuchen, zwei separate Datenbanken zu synchronisieren, da es eine Vielzahl von Problemen einlädt. Wie können Sie beispielsweise Daten in Echtzeit wiederherstellen? Erwägen Sie stattdessen, jeden Tag einen Batch-Job auszuführen, um einen Snapshot in die Backup-Datenbank zu verschieben. –
Dies wird nicht als Synchronisation bezeichnet, dies wird als Replikation bezeichnet. Die meisten rdbms-Produkte verfügen über Replikationsfunktionen, sodass Sie keinen Ruhezustand benötigen. Die externe Datenbank wird der Master sein, der lokale wird der Slave sein. – Shadow
Was ist mit einem Auslöser? Ist das ein großer Tisch? – Thomas